About The Science of Secrets

The Science of Secrets "Chemistry that ignites the soul." Amidst the metallic clanging and bubbling of the chemical plant in 20th century Germany, an intricate dance of secrets unfolds as Klaus Fischer, Stefan Müller, Anna Lehmann, Hanna Schmitt, and Simon König navigate the treacherous waters of chemistry and politics. The Science of Secrets is a gripping historical novel that illuminates the mysteries of chemistry and the human heart with poetic prose and masterful storytelling. Characters Klaus is a brooding, mysterious figure; his brilliant mind cloaked by piercing eyes and dark locks of hair. He is driven by the passion for chemistry yet troubled by his past, choosing to keep himself in introspective seclusion. Stefan, Klaus's colleague and friend in the lab. He has a quick wit and is always ready with a joke to break the tension. He has messy brown hair and hazel eyes. Anna, Klaus's wife who also works at the plant as an assistant chemist. She is graceful and practical, with long blonde hair that she often wears in a bun. Hanna, a secretary at the plant who becomes involved in Klaus's life in unexpected ways. She is kind-hearted but restless, with short wavy brown hair. Simon, an enigmatic figure who appears at the plant one day with unknown intentions. He exudes charm but has a dangerous edge to him. He has jet black hair and piercing green eyes.
